25% and Up: The 5 DC-Area Zip Codes Where Home Prices Appreciated The Most in 2021

Home prices have been rising for years in the DC region, but, as UrbanTurf has reported, only started to skyrocket in 2021. 

Using the median sales price for zip codes, we highlighted the areas in the region where prices have appreciated the most in 2021. So far this year, homes in five zip codes have seen prices rise at least 25% compared to 2020.

Leading the way are three zip codes where home prices have appreciated at least 27% and the main property type is detached single-family homes:

  • 22066 -- Home to Great Falls and Shady Oak in Virginia and runs along the Potomac River. 
  • 20814 -- The Maryland zip code that includes downtown Bethesda and the areas just to the north. 
  • 20817 -- The Bethesda zip code just adjacent to 20814. 

Rounding out the top five are two DC zip codes where home prices appreciated 25% -- 20015, home to Chevy Chase DC, Barnaby Woods and Friendship Heights; and 20037, home to West End and Foggy Bottom.
